What Is “Letter from Lamin Ceesay”?
A letter from Lamin Ceesay is a monthly newsletter—a journey of thought, a reflective pause, and a meeting place between you and the storyteller’s “I”.
As an author rooted in Gambian literature and African heritage, I use this letter to explore the quiet truths behind the noise. Expect:
- Deep personal essays
- Behind-the-scenes insights into my books
- African storytelling traditions and cultural notes
- Reflections on identity, migration, and resilience
- Book reviews, poetry, and writing news
I write from Gambia, Italy, and the spaces in between—where home, hope, and humanity meet.
